What is the molarity/concentration of a solution if a volume of 2 liters of a 3 M solution is diluted to a final volume of 6 liters? [Use M2 = M1V1/V2]
1 M
0.5 M
2 M
1.5 M

If 50 mL of a 0.1 M NaCl solution is diluted to 200 mL, what is the new concentration? [Use M2 = M1V1/V2]
0.025 M
0.05 M
0.1 M
0.2 M
